Asbestos lawsuits are different from other types of personal injury cases in that they require special expertise. A mesothelioma company focuses exclusively on asbestos litigation and has the expertise required to determine the potential causes of asbestos exposure, examine medical records and evaluate mesothelioma symptoms. Firms specializing in asbestos litigation are equipped with exclusive databases and extensive industry resources that help connect the mesothelioma symptoms of a person to previous asbestos exposure.

Due to the long time lag that mesothelioma sufferers experience, it is difficult to determine an individual's exact exposure to asbestos. This is particularly true since asbestos businesses that put workers at risk often ended up going out of business or changed their names, or merged with other corporations. Many Asbestos Claim - Http://Wiki.Motorclass.Com.Au/Index.Php/Ten_Common_Misconceptions_About_Causes_Of_Mesothelioma_Other_Than_Asbestos_That_Don_T_Always_Hold, companies have also filed for bankruptcy, even before their mesothelioma patients develop. A mesothelioma lawyer who is skilled can assist asbestos victims and their families understand the complex bankruptcy trust system and government assistance for asbestos victims.

Time Frame

To start a asbestos lawsuit, the victims have to act swiftly. In some cases there is a statute of limitations that is in place to safeguard victims' legal rights. This period of time is crucial, as it can affect the amount of compensation. The longer a victim takes to file, the lower the settlement amount they could be.

The statute of limitations is a law that specifies the deadline for filing criminal and civil cases. It usually is based on the date of an accident or illness and differs from state to state. Personal injury cases that aren't asbestos-related usually have a duration of one to four years. However, since asbestos-related diseases such as mesothelioma have a long latency period the statute of limitations starts when symptoms are detected instead of on the date of exposure.
